  • Patent number: 11067553
    Abstract: A method for determination and isolation for abnormal sub-sensors in a multi-core sensor. It can be intelligently determined whether the reason for an abrupt dramatic change in sensor data is a sensor fault or sudden pollution, so as to increase data reliability. A data online rate is increased if a repair can be performed via automatic determination when a device fault occurs, which has significant value for continuous monitoring required for a haze treatment operation. In addition, human and material resources for device maintenance may be saved, thereby reducing waste.

  • Publication number: 20210140930
    Abstract: The disclosure provides a method for selecting bus lines through collaborative monitoring of taxis and buses. The method focuses on road network of an urban area, by installing air pollution detection equipment on the mobile monitoring vehicles, to monitor air quality of the urban area. The method includes establishing a curve model of monitoring times for the taxis; establishing a curve model of monitoring times for each bus line, in which its horizontal axis is consistent with the horizontal axis of the taxi detection frequency curve model; assigning monitoring times to the corresponding road section unit; sorting each bus line according to the numbers of undetected segments the each bus line covers; and selecting the bus routes participating in collaborative monitoring.

  • Patent number: 10745248
    Abstract: A handrail belt tension device is provided for an escalator having a truss and an annular handrail belt rotatable relative to the truss. The handrail belt tension device includes: a base plate on which a roller for supporting the handrail belt is provided, and a guiding mechanism which is fixed to the truss. The base plate is connected to the guiding mechanism, and rotatable and translatable relative to the guiding mechanism so as to adjust the handrail belt by the base plate thereby the handrail belt can be in a well tensioned status. The handrail belt tension device ensures that the tension device is installed in a more accurate position, making it easier to adjust the tensioning force of the handrail belt, reducing the time for adjusting the handrail belt, and increasing the service life of the handrail belt.

  • Patent number: 7681116
    Abstract: Automatically republishing native data from a native data file into a published file. In response to initially publishing the native data into the published file, a publish object is created that corresponds to the published data and the native data. The publish object is associated with the native data file and indicates whether the native data is to be automatically republished upon resaving of the native data file. The publish object further indicates the location of the published file, a reference to the location of the native data within the native data file, and an alert string. The publish object is identified by a unique identifier that is also stored in the published file to indicate the location of the published data. In response to resaving the native data, the publish object is examined to determine whether the native data is to be automatically republished.
